Simply put, a pasture seed drill is a sowing implement—usually mounted on a tractor or pulled behind—that places seeds at a specific depth and spacing in the soil. Unlike scattering seeds by hand or with a broadcast spreader, the seed drill uses multiple small tubes or “seed boots” that open slits in the ground and deposit seed evenly.
In a modern agricultural context, these drills evolve beyond just distribution tools. Today, manufacturers design them for diverse terrains, seed types (including pulse crops and grasses), and variable row widths, all while reducing soil disturbance. The goal? To mimic natural seeding patterns but with much higher efficiency.

Quality steel frames, corrosion-resistant parts, and rugged design ensure that pasture seed drills endure harsh field conditions. It’s vital, especially for farmers in wet or dusty environments, where equipment reliability matters day-in, day-out.
Good seed drills offer precise seed flow control, usually via mechanical or air-assist metering systems. This controls seed rate to avoid waste, which directly impacts input costs and pasture density later on.
Modern drills can handle multiple seed types from fine grass seeds to larger legumes. Some designs even allow adjustable row spacing—important depending on pasture species or soil compaction issues.
Simple calibration, intuitive adjustments, and accessible components make it easier for farmers to set drills according to seed type and soil type, increasing efficiency.
While upfront cost matters, many farmers realize long-term savings due to less seed wastage and improved seedling survival rates with these drills.

Farmers across continents rely on pasture seed drills. In New Zealand, they’re almost a standard on dairy farms aiming for dense, nutritious ryegrass pastures. Australian ranchers use them extensively to recover rangelands after droughts—a tough but necessary task to preserve livestock feed.
In Europe and Canada, where sustainable livestock systems are emphasized, seed drills are part of rewilding and permaculture projects that integrate pasture and crop rotations. Even in parts of Africa, NGOs working on post-disaster agricultural rehabilitation leverage these drills to quickly restore community grazing lands and reduce famine risk.

A rotary tiller uses a set of rotating blades, often called tines, to break up and aerate the soil. These tines churn the soil, reducing it to a fine tilth, which is ideal for seed germination and root development. Unlike traditional plowing, which inverts the soil, a tiller blends organic matter and weeds into the soil, enriching it. The depth of tilling can often be adjusted, allowing for various levels of soil preparation. Zinanmech offers a range of high-quality rotary tillers to suit different needs and applications. Rotary tillers are versatile tools with a wide range of applications. They're commonly used for: Preparing new garden beds: Breaking up compacted soil to create a suitable growing medium. Weed control: Incorporating weeds into the soil, disrupting their growth cycle. Incorporating fertilizers and compost: Mixing amendments into the soil for improved nutrient availability. Seedbed preparation: Creating a fine tilth for optimal seed germination. Mixing cover crops: Incorporating cover crops into the soil to improve soil health. Cultivating between rows: Maintaining weed-free rows in established gardens.

At the heart of a rotary tiller is a set of rotating blades, or tines, powered by an engine – typically gasoline, diesel, or electric. As the tiller moves forward, these tines churn into the soil, breaking it apart and mixing in organic matter. The depth of tillage can usually be adjusted, allowing you to control how finely the soil is broken up. This process improves soil aeration, drainage, and overall fertility, creating an ideal seedbed.

Tractor tillers come in various types, each designed for specific tasks and soil conditions. The most common types include rear-mounted tillers, three-point hitch tillers, and front-mounted tillers. Rear-mounted tillers are typically more affordable, while front-mounted tillers offer greater visibility and maneuverability. Three-point hitch tillers provide versatility and compatibility with a wider range of tractors. The price of a tiller is heavily influenced by its type, size, and features. Several factors contribute to the final price of a tractor tiller. These include the tiller's working width, horsepower requirements, the quality of the blades, and the presence of additional features like adjustable depth control and safety shields.

The most significant is the power source: manual, electric, or gas. Manual rototillers are the least expensive, requiring human power to operate. Electric models, both corded and cordless, offer a balance of power and convenience at a moderate price point. Gas-powered rototillers are the most powerful and typically the most expensive, suitable for larger areas and tougher soil.
